Does anyone have a permanent solution to error 0xc0000142?

  • May 21, 2026
  • 1 reply
  • 15 views

I have experienced this error (0xc0000142) when attempting to open InDesign and illustrator several times over the course of a few months now. There is a fix that I found through the Adobe forums that involves repairing the Microsoft Visual C++ Redistributable program files and it works temporarily, but after a few weeks the problem reappears. I have tried installing several versions of both programs to see if it is just affecting a specific version, but it does not appear to make a difference.

Any help toward a permanent fix is appreciated, as I require authorization from my company’s tech support department in order to perform the fix every time this problem occurs and it is interfering with my job. Thank you
